Clacton & Tendring Shop Mobility
Clacton & Tendring Shop Mobility is a registered charity that is dedicated to promoting the welfare and independence of people with mobility impairments, whether temporary or permanent. Shop mobility provides powered scooters / wheelchairs and manual wheelchairs.

Holiday Accommodation
Some of the accommodation on this site MAY be suitable for those visitors with visual, hearing or physical impairments. We would advise that you check your requirements with the proprietor of the establishment before booking.

National Accessible Scheme
Proprietors of accommodation taking part in the National Accessible Scheme are committed to accessibility. If you have particular mobility, visual or hearing needs, look out for our National Accessible Scheme.

You can be confident of finding accommodation or attractions that meet your needs by looking for the nationally recognised symbols. Properties and attractions displaying these symbols will have met the National Accessible Scheme criteria. If you have addition special needs or requirements you are recommended to make sure that these can be met by your chosen establishment before confirming your reservation.

Toilets
Many of the District’s public toilets have facilities operated by the National Radar Key System. For a full listing of accessible toilets or to purchase a Radar key contact one of our local Tourist Information Centres.


Car Parking
Mobility vehicles may be parked free of charge on all Council car parks for up to three hours in any one day, providing a blue parking badge is displayed correctly and the clock is set accurately. Disabled badge holders are entitled to unlimited parking in designated on street parking areas, which are marked with a white broken line (excluding permit zones).

Provisions in Theatres/Cinemas
Both the Princes and West Cliff Theatres in Clacton, the Electric Palace Cinema in Harwich and Frinton Summer Theatre have designated spaces suitable for wheelchair users and carer’s / support workers. However we would recommend that you discuss any specific needs at the time of booking your tickets.
